Description

This form provides for a conveyance of a royalty interest for a term, the duration of which is the life of an existing oil and gas lease.

A royalty deed gives its holder the right to receive a percentage of the profits from the sale of the minerals, if and when they are actually produced. This kind of legal document does not convey all of the mineral rights to the holder, only the right to receive royalties.

The only way to add or remove a name on a deed is to have a new deed recorded. Once a document is recorded, it cannot be altered. In order to protect your legal interests, we strongly suggest that you contact an attorney to have this done for you.

A royalty interest is a property interest that entitles the owner to receive a share of the production revenue. An individual or company that owns a royalty interest does not have to pay for any of the operational costs required to produce the resource, but they still own a portion of the revenue produced.

Mineral rights deeds are not the same as royalty deeds. Royalty deeds do not allow for surface access, or for the initiation of the extraction and sale of minerals. A royalty owner will only benefit economically if the mineral owner decides to produce and sell the minerals.

When the mineral interest owner becomes inactive or simply abandons the parcel of land and stops exploring or exploiting oil and gas and other resources ? as well as the oil and gas wells ? present beneath the land for an extended period, the rights may become abandoned. As a result, the mineral rights expire.

What is the difference between working interest and royalty interest? Working interests are oil and gas investments that give owners the right to exploit the resources on a property. Royalty interests are the rights belonging to the landowner who leased out the property to the working interest owner.
